Understanding the Mechanics of the Crash Game
At its heart, the crash game operates on a provably fair system, meaning the outcome of each round is determined by a cryptographic algorithm that is transparent and verifiable. Players can often check the fairness of the results themselves, ensuring the game isn't rigged. Initially, a starting multiplier of 1x is displayed. This multiplier begins to ascend, often at a gradually accelerating rate. The longer the game continues without crashing, the higher the multiplier goes, potentially reaching incredibly lucrative levels. However, this increase isn’t limitless; the crash is guaranteed to happen eventually. The exact point at which it occurs is random, governed by the aforementioned algorithm.
Players place their bets before each round begins. Once the round starts, the multiplier begins to rise, and players have the option to “cash out” at any moment. Cashing out before the crash secures their winnings, calculated by multiplying their initial bet by the current multiplier. If the player fails to cash out before the multiplier crashes, they lose their entire bet. This simple principle creates a high-pressure environment that tests a player's nerves and decision-making skills. Successful play requires a combination of strategy, risk assessment, and a bit of luck. Mastering the nuances of the game involves understanding probabilities and developing a personalized cashing out strategy.
Developing a Cashing Out Strategy
There are numerous approaches to developing a cashing out strategy. Some players opt for a conservative strategy, consistently cashing out at lower multipliers (e.g., 1.2x – 1.5x) to secure small but frequent wins. This approach minimizes risk but also limits potential profits. Others prefer a more aggressive strategy, aiming for higher multipliers (e.g., 2x or more), accepting a greater risk of losing their bet in pursuit of larger payouts. A popular technique is the "martingale" system where, after a loss, the player doubles their bet on the next round, aiming to recoup their losses and a small profit with a single win. However, the martingale system can be dangerous as it requires a substantial bankroll and doesn’t eliminate the risk of prolonged losing streaks.
Another commonly used strategy is setting pre-determined cash-out points and sticking to them regardless of the multiplier’s trajectory. This disciplined approach helps to avoid impulsive decisions driven by greed or fear. It is important to remember that there is no guaranteed winning strategy in a crash game, as the crash is ultimately random. However, a well-thought-out strategy can significantly improve your chances of consistently profiting and maximizing your enjoyment of the game. Analyzing past game results and identifying patterns can also inform your strategy, though past performance is never a guarantee of future outcomes.

The Psychology of Crash Games
The inherent suspense of the crash game is heavily reliant on psychological principles. The continuous rise of the multiplier triggers a sense of anticipation and excitement, often leading to a state of heightened arousal. This arousal can impair rational decision-making, causing players to hold on for longer than they initially intended, hoping for an even greater payout. This phenomenon, known as the “hot hand fallacy,” is the belief that streaks of success increase the likelihood of future success – a belief that is demonstrably false in games of chance. Players may become emotionally invested in the process, leading to impulsive and risky behavior.
The fear of missing out (FOMO) also plays a significant role. Witnessing others cash out at high multipliers can create a sense of regret and a desire to chase those same returns. This can lead to increasingly reckless betting and a disregard for previously established strategies. The game’s fast-paced nature further exacerbates these psychological effects, leaving little time for rational thought and careful consideration. It's crucial to recognize these psychological biases and actively counteract them by maintaining a disciplined approach and adhering to a predetermined strategy. Understanding these mental traps is key to preventing costly mistakes.

The Rise of Provably Fair Technology
A significant factor contributing to the increasing popularity of the crash game, and online casinos in general, is the adoption of provably fair technology. Traditionally, players had to trust that the casino operator was acting with integrity and not manipulating the outcomes of the games. Provably fair systems eliminate this need for trust. These systems utilize cryptographic algorithms to generate random game outcomes that are transparent and verifiable by the player. This means that players can independently confirm that each game result is truly random and hasn't been tampered with.
The process typically involves the casino providing a seed value, and the player providing their own seed value. These seeds are combined and used to generate a hash, which determines the outcome of the game. Players can then use the provided seed values to independently verify the hash and confirm the fairness of the result. This level of transparency builds confidence and trust between the player and the casino, fostering a more secure and enjoyable gaming experience. The implementation of provably fair technology is a testament to the growing demand for accountability and transparency within the online gambling industry. It provides players with peace of mind and ensures that the games are genuinely fair.
How Provably Fair Systems Work
Underlying provably fair systems are complex cryptographic principles, but the basic concept is relatively straightforward. The casino and player each contribute a random seed – a string of characters. These seeds are then combined with a hashing algorithm (like SHA256) to create a unique hash. This hash is used to generate the game's outcome, guaranteeing randomness. Before the game begins, the casino reveals its seed. The player also provides their seed, often generated client-side, making it tamper-proof. After the game, players can verify the result by running the same hashing algorithm using both seeds. If the generated hash matches the one provided by the casino, the game’s fairness is confirmed.
Various tools and websites exist to help players verify the provably fair results of games. These tools simplify the hashing process and provide a user-friendly interface for confirmation.
